The Science Behind Hypospadias: What You Need to Know

Defining Hypospadias: More Than Just a Medical Term

Hypospadias is a congenital condition that affects the male urethra and is characterized by an abnormal placement of the urethral opening. Instead of being located at the tip of the penis, as in typical anatomy, the urethral meatus can occur anywhere along the underside, from just below the tip to the scrotum. This condition can lead to complications such as difficulties with urination, recurrent urinary tract infections, and challenges during sexual intercourse. Initially identified in infancy, the condition is much more common than one might anticipate, affecting approximately 1 in 250 live births. Understanding hypospadias necessitates an awareness of its implications, both physical and psychological, on affected individuals as they navigate their developmental years into adulthood.

The Anatomy of the Condition: Understanding the Variations

Hypospadias exists on a spectrum, classified into several types based on the location of the urethral opening. These include glanular (at the glans), penile (along the shaft), and perineal (near the scrotum). Each of these variants presents unique challenges and considerations for surgical intervention. For instance, glanular hypospadias often involves less complexity in repair and may exhibit fewer post-surgical complications compared to more distal presentations such as penoscrotal hypospadias. Furthermore, accompanying anatomical anomalies, such as chordee (curvature of the penis), may necessitate more intricate surgical correction to achieve a successful functional and aesthetic outcome. Understanding these variations is crucial for both patients and caregivers in making informed decisions regarding treatment options and expectations post-repair.

Common Myths Surrounding Hypospadias Explained

Misinformation often surrounds hypospadias, leading to misconceptions that can affect patient and family decision-making. A prevalent myth is that hypospadias is linked to poor hygiene or negligence during pregnancy, which is untrue; it results from complex genetic and environmental factors that are not entirely understood. Another common misconception is that all cases require surgical intervention. While surgery is usually recommended for severe variants to ensure normal urinary function and prevent further complications, mild cases might not necessitate immediate surgery, and some children may grow up without any symptoms. Lastly, the myth that hypospadias inherently affects sexual function or fertility in the future is largely unfounded. Many individuals with properly repaired hypospadias can lead full, healthy sexual lives. Addressing these myths is crucial for alleviating anxiety and fostering a supportive environment for those impacted by the condition.

Surgical Techniques Unveiled: A Deep Dive into Repair Options

Overview of Surgical Approaches: From Classic to Innovative

The field of hypospadias repair has evolved significantly over the past few decades, with a comprehensive array of surgical techniques available to address the diverse manifestations of the condition. Traditional methods, such as the tubularized incised plate (TIP) urethroplasty, have been widely adopted due to their reliability and relatively straightforward execution. In this procedure, the urethral plate is incised and tubularized to create a new urethra, ideally aligning with the tip of the penis. Innovations have led to the development of more advanced techniques, such as the use of tissue flaps and grafts; the fascial graft, in particular, involves harvesting tissue from the child’s own body to ensure compatibility and minimize rejection. Adult patients undergoing secondary surgeries often benefit from these techniques as well, demonstrating the adaptability and continual progression of surgical methodologies in this area.

Decoding the Details: How Surgeons Make Incisions

The intricacies of surgical technique play a critical role in the success of hypospadias repair. Surgeons must carefully consider incision placement based on the type of hypospadias being treated, the condition of surrounding tissues, and the presence of any additional anomalies like chordee. Generally, the incisions are made along the skin of the penile shaft, with the primary goal of re-establishing a functional and aesthetically pleasing urinary vent. In cases of more complicated anatomies, a degloving technique may be utilized wherein the skin is separated from the underlying tissues, allowing for thorough examination and correction of the urethra and any additional issues such as scarring or chordee. Ultimately, the skill and experience of the surgical team are paramount, as they navigate these anatomical considerations to optimize outcomes.

Choosing the Right Technique: Factors Influencing Surgical Decisions

Deciding on a surgical technique for hypospadias repair is a multifaceted process influenced by various factors, including the severity of hypospadias, the child’s age, and the presence of any additional medical conditions. Surgeons typically prefer to conduct repairs when the child is between six months and one year old, due to the lower risks of complications and the potential to achieve better outcomes with less scarring. The specific anatomical features of the hypospadias also guide surgical decisions; cases with significant curvature may demand more intricate correction methods such as chordee release procedures to align the penis appropriately. Family preferences, perceptions of surgical risks, and the overall health of the child are pivotal in ensuring that each case is approached with a tailored strategy for the best possible outcome.

Navigating the Recovery Journey: Post-Operative Care and Expectations

The First Few Days: What to Expect After Surgery

The initial recovery phase following hypospadias surgery is crucial for both the child and caregivers, requiring close monitoring and adherence to post-operative protocols. In the first few days, discomfort is common, as patients may experience swelling and bruising in the surgical site. Healthcare providers typically recommend hospitalization for at least 24 hours to control pain and manage any potential complications. During this period, caregivers are educated on how to care for the surgical area, which may include practices such as regular cleaning with mild soap and water, and ensuring that the area remains dry. It’s not uncommon for patients to have a catheter in place for several days post-surgery to facilitate proper urination while the urethra heals. Understanding the potential barriers and what to anticipate in these early stages can significantly alleviate anxiety and promote a smoother recovery experience.

Pain Management and Comfort: Tools for the Healing Process

A well-structured pain management plan is essential during recovery, as adequate pain control can significantly enhance the overall recovery experience. Pediatricians often prescribe a combination of over-the-counter pain relievers such as acetaminophen or ibuprofen, tailored to the specific needs of the child. Non-medical comfort measures, including the use of ice packs around the surgical site (not directly on the skin, to prevent frostbite), can help manage swelling and discomfort. Additionally, ensuring that the child remains well-hydrated and nourished can aid in their recovery process. In some cases, pain management may also involve emotional support, reassuring the child and addressing any fears and concerns regarding their condition and the surgery. A holistic approach to comfort that considers physical pain alongside emotional wellbeing can foster a more positive recovery experience.

Monitoring Progress: Signs of Healing vs. Complications

The period following hypospadias repair necessitates vigilant observation for both signs of healing and potential complications. Normal healing can be characterized by decreasing pain, gradual reduction in swelling, and the appearance of scar tissue at the site of incision. Parents should remain alert to any red flags, such as severe unrelenting pain, signs of infection (including fever or unusual discharge), or any noticeable changes in urination, indicative of urinary obstruction. Regular follow-up appointments with the surgeon are essential for assessing healing stages and addressing any concerns. By maintaining an open line of communication with healthcare providers and understanding the indicators of healthy recovery, families can effectively navigate this critical phase.

Long-Term Outcomes and Future Considerations: Life Beyond Repair

Assessing Results: Success Rates and Patient Satisfaction

The success of hypospadias repair can be quantified through various metrics, including the ability to urinate normally, the aesthetic appearance of the penis, and the absence of complications such as urethral strictures or reoperation. Recent studies suggest that the overall success rate for primary hypospadias repairs sits around 85-90%, though this can vary significantly based on the repair technique utilized and the severity of the condition. Patient satisfaction plays a significant role in assessing long-term outcomes. Health-related quality of life measures indicate that individuals who have undergone successful repair often report outcomes aligning with their peers regarding urinary function and sexual health. Nevertheless, long-term follow-up is crucial, as some may encounter issues such as psychological distress related to body image or sexual function that may necessitate additional interventions or supportive care.

Psychosocial Impact: How Hypospadias Repair Affects Quality of Life

The psychosocial ramifications of hypospadias and its subsequent repair can significantly influence an individual’s self-esteem and quality of life. Early surgical intervention often helps alleviate physical distress, fostering a sense of normalcy as the child grows. However, ongoing psychological support is sometimes required, especially for adolescents who may experience anxiety or self-consciousness regarding their condition post-repair. Awareness campaigns focusing on hypospadias can be instrumental in reducing stigma and promoting a healthier dialogue about genital conditions. Access to counseling and peer support groups can offer invaluable resources for affected individuals and families, enhancing resilience and coping strategies faced on this journey.

Staying Informed: Future Advances in Hypospadias Treatment

The future of hypospadias treatment is promising, with ongoing research and technological advancements poised to enhance surgical techniques and improve patient outcomes. Innovations such as minimally invasive approaches and regenerative medicine are currently being explored, aiming to reduce recovery times and improve aesthetic outcomes. Integration of 3D imaging technology allows for better pre-surgical planning, potentially leading to a reduction in complications and optimized surgical results. Moreover, ongoing studies aim to uncover the genetic underpinnings of hypospadias, which could pave the way for prenatal interventions or preventative strategies in high-risk populations.
